Buying Guide
Why a portable monitor? For many remote workers and content creators, a second screen improves multitasking, speeds up editing, and reduces context switching. When shopping for a travel monitor, prioritize a few key areas: resolution and panel type (IPS for wider viewing angles), brightness (for working in bright cafes), connectivity (USB-C with power delivery is the most convenient), weight and thickness (lighter is better for backpacks), and protective accessories (smart covers or sleeves to avoid scratches).
Connectivity: USB-C that supports DisplayPort Alt Mode makes the cleanest single-cable setup—your laptop charges and outputs video over one cable. If your device lacks USB-C video, look for HDMI input or bundled adapters. For consoles like the Switch or PS, HDMI is essential.
Color and brightness: IPS panels give consistent colors and wide viewing angles, which is helpful when you’re sharing the screen or doing photo/video edits. 250–350 nits is usually enough for indoor and outdoor cafe work; if you often work outside in direct sun, choose a brighter panel.
Build and portability: Smart covers that double as stands are common and save space, but magnetic fold stands or integrated kickstands can be sturdier. Also check if a screen protector, travel case, or speakers are included—these small extras make travel life easier.
Performance vs price: Higher refresh rates and HDR offer advantages for gaming and media, but they add cost. Most productivity-focused nomads will be happiest with a 60Hz, 1080p IPS display that balances image quality and battery-friendly operation.
Who should read this guide: remote workers, video editors on a budget, digital creatives who travel, and hybrid gamers who want a console-friendly portable screen. If you rarely travel or already have a full desktop setup, a portable monitor may add little value.

ASUS ZenScreen 15.6” Portable Monitor for Laptop (MB169CK) – Dual USB-C, Mini-HDMI, Plug & Play External Screen for Travel Dual Setup, Full HD, IPS, Anti-Glare Surface, 360° Kickstand, 3yr Warranty
Best For:
Professionals and frequent travelers who want ergonomic flexibility and brand-backed reliability.
The ASUS ZenScreen MB169CK stands out in the portable monitor niche by blending thoughtful ergonomics with strong brand reliability. It features a 15.6" Full HD IPS panel with anti-glare coating and dual USB-C ports, plus a Mini-HDMI option for broader compatibility. Its 360° kickstand design is particularly flexible—flip it into portrait mode for long documents or code reviews and use the anti-glare surface to reduce reflections in bright spaces. ASUS’s reputation for durable hardware and a three-year warranty gives extra peace of mind for frequent travelers.
Main benefits: The dual USB-C ports often translate to simpler cable routing and more reliable charging while using video output. Anti-glare coating helps when you’re working in coffee shops with overhead lights or near windows. The 360° kickstand is more versatile than most smart covers, letting you orient the screen to suit different tasks—portrait for reading or long spreadsheets, landscape for video and design previews.
Real-life usage examples: A freelance writer might use the ZenScreen in portrait mode to view long research documents while drafting on a laptop screen. A developer traveling between client sites can use the extra screen for logs and terminal windows, rotating to portrait for long lists. Photographers and video editors can use the Mini-HDMI input to preview camera footage without juggling adapters. The anti-glare finish reduces eye strain during long work sessions.
Why this monitor is valuable: Its ergonomic flexibility and port selection make it better suited to people who need a bit more than a basic second screen. Compared to no-name portable panels, the ZenScreen’s build quality, warranty, and adjustable stand make it a safer bet for professionals who rely on their gear.
Who should buy it: Professionals who need dependable hardware and ergonomic flexibility—writers, developers, photographers who travel, and hybrid office workers.
Who may not need it: Budget buyers who only need occasional second-screen functionality and don’t require a long warranty or advanced stand options.
Practical observations and buying considerations: Take advantage of the extra USB-C port for daisy-chaining or alternate power sources. The anti-glare surface is great for bright rooms but slightly softens contrast compared with glossy displays.
